About ANIQO
ANIQO is the musical project of Berlin- and Lisbon-based singer-songwriter and visual artist Anita Goß. Her songs move between dark art pop, spiritual folk and cinematic songwriting. At the centre of her work is her emotional and unmistakable voice, framed by psychedelic and tender guitars, orchestral textures, strings and organ arrangements. Her songs do not rush toward resolution - they remain within the emotional weather of change.
ANIQO recorded her first songs in Los Angeles in 2017 with Joe Cardamone. Only a handful were released, including the indie-pop track ‘New Signs’ feat. Annie Hardy of Giant Drag, while her music videos, such as ‘Chess’, were featured on the website of Black Rebel Motorcycle Club. Her first fully realised album, ‘BIRTH’, was recorded in Berlin in 2020 with jazz and analogue recording specialist Guy Sternberg and released in 2022. It received international attention and outstanding reviews from magazines such as Rolling Stone Germany, Clash and Wonderland. She also performed at renowned festivals and showcases including Fusion Festival and Pop-Kultur Berlin.
In 2025 ANIQO released the stand-alone single ‘The Call’ with a remix by Howie B on La Double Vie. She is currently preparing the release of her forthcoming album ‘EARTH, LOVE AND VARIATIONS’, produced with Bill Ryder-Jones in England in 2024 and 2025.
